What Is a Hotness Calculator?

A Hotness Calculator estimates personal attractiveness using a combination of inputs. While results are meant for fun, the calculator provides a numeric score or rating that reflects user-provided attributes.

Typical uses include:

  • Fun self-assessment
  • Social media sharing and challenges
  • Friendly comparisons with friends
  • Confidence boosting in a playful context

It is important to remember that this tool is for entertainment purposes only and not a professional assessment of beauty or attractiveness.
